Identifying a Fake Patek Philippe: Detailed Examination Tips

Uncovering a bogus Patek Philippe timepiece requires a careful evaluation. Begin with the general look; a noticeably light weight compared to the genuine model is a significant red signal. Next, carefully examine the face. Pay close heed to the texture; minor imperfections in the marking or unbalanced illumination can be telling. The engine, if accessible, should be impeccably finished, with regular stamps; reproductions often lack this level of detail. Furthermore, check the state of the sapphire; replica pieces often employ substandard materials. Lastly, analyze the engravings on the back; incorrect fonts or distance are common signals of a false product. Remember that professional confirmation is always recommended for high-value timepieces like Patek Philippe.

Identifying copyright Patek Philippe Watches: Key Details

The allure of Patek Philippe's exquisite timepieces frequently attracts unscrupulous individuals crafting convincing forgeries. Safeguarding your investment requires careful inspection. Pay close attention to the movement – a genuine Patek Philippe will possess a meticulously detailed engine with Geneva stripes and other hallmarks, while fakes often have rudimentary or no decoration. Examine the dial; correct fonts, precise printing, and impeccable placement of the Patek Philippe logo are critical; reproductions often show inconsistencies here. The density also provides a clue - genuine Patek Philippes are made from superior materials, resulting in a noticeably heavier feel. Furthermore, the serial number location and markings should be consistent with Patek Philippe’s practices – seek expert validation if in doubt. Ultimately, purchasing from an reputable dealer remains the safest route to acquisition of a genuine masterpiece.
